Skip to content
Kembali
Case Study

Snapstrip

Web-Based Photobooth Application

Snapstrip

Snapstrip adalah aplikasi photobooth berbasis web yang dirancang untuk menghadirkan pengalaman fotografi interaktif secara digital, praktis, dan modern. Platform ini memungkinkan pengguna untuk mengambil foto langsung dari perangkat, memilih frame, serta menerapkan berbagai filter visual secara real-time.

Dengan pendekatan desain yang clean dan user-friendly, Snapstrip tidak hanya berfungsi sebagai alat pengambilan gambar, tetapi juga sebagai media ekspresi visual yang menyenangkan dan mudah diakses tanpa perlu instalasi aplikasi tambahan.

Latar Belakang
Tren photobooth digital semakin meningkat, terutama dalam kebutuhan dokumentasi momen secara instan dan shareable di media sosial. Namun, sebagian besar solusi masih terbatas pada aplikasi mobile atau perangkat fisik tertentu.

Snapstrip dikembangkan sebagai solusi berbasis web yang fleksibel dan dapat diakses kapan saja dan di mana saja, tanpa bergantung pada platform tertentu. Fokus utama pengembangan adalah kemudahan penggunaan, performa, serta pengalaman visual yang menarik.

Fitur Utama

  • Pengambilan foto langsung melalui kamera perangkat (webcam integration)

  • Pilihan berbagai frame photostrip yang aesthetic dan customizable

  • Filter foto real-time untuk meningkatkan visual hasil gambar

  • Multi-shot mode (beberapa foto dalam satu sesi)

  • Preview hasil photostrip sebelum download

  • Download hasil dalam format gambar siap share

  • UI/UX yang clean, modern, dan mobile-friendly

  • Tanpa instalasi (fully web-based)

  • Optimasi performa untuk akses cepat

  • Struktur halaman terpisah (landing page & capture page)

Peran & Kontribusi

  • Mengembangkan aplikasi frontend secara end-to-end

  • Mendesain pengalaman pengguna yang intuitif dan engaging

  • Mengimplementasikan fitur kamera berbasis web API

  • Membangun sistem frame dan filter yang dinamis

  • Mengoptimalkan performa rendering dan image processing

  • Menyusun arsitektur komponen yang modular dan scalable

  • Mengelola state dan interaksi pengguna secara efisien

  • Menerapkan best practices dalam clean code dan maintainability

Dampak & Hasil

  • Menyediakan alternatif photobooth digital tanpa perangkat khusus

  • Meningkatkan kemudahan pengguna dalam membuat konten visual

  • Mendukung kebutuhan social sharing dengan hasil instan

  • Memberikan pengalaman interaktif yang menarik dan modern

  • Memperluas potensi penggunaan untuk event, personal use, dan branding

Tech Stack

Next.jsTypeScriptTailwind CSSFramer MotionWebRTCCanvas API